Today, I quit smoking. I am not the type to prepare for extended periods of time, as I find that gives me a chance to "mentaly talk myself out of it."

I will be drawing on my "lessons" (previous attempts) in the hope that this time, it's for good. One thing that I will be using and employing, is what I learnt when I quit smoking last time. I quit for just under 4 months. I went cold turkey from the moment I stepped onto a plane oversea's. All my habits (eating, sleeping, language, EVERYTHING) was getting shaken up, so why not kick ciggies too?

I thought of myself as an ex-smoker, I had great support from a friend who I travelled with and I managed to get through the cravings. I have never felt so fit, healthy, alive, vibrant, I even felt like I looked better.
